加拿大国际镍公司日产35,000吨的克拉雷倍尔厂已于1971年11月投产,设计中采用更多的自动化仪表、载流分析仪和过程控制计算机,这些对于有效操作都是必需的。载流分析仪每6到12分钟提供浮选控制计算机用的铜、镍、铁、硫和硅的分析数据。计算机给出报表(班次、现状、警报等)并控制分析仪、加药及浮选回路,本文叙述分析仪-计算机系统及它对工厂成绩的影响。
